The Grammys are one of the biggest nights of the year in showbiz and after a year of disappointing awards shows due to the pandemic, the Grammys was one of the few awards shows that had a red carpet this year. After being postponed, the show went on, and there were some amazing outfits gracing the red carpet. Here were our favorites of the night.
Megan Thee Stallion
Megan Thee Stallion, who won Best New Artist, Best Rap Performance, and made history as the first female artist to win Best Rap Song, showed she has body for days in this bright orange Dolce & Gabanna gown with a huge, oversized bow in the back.

Taylor Swift
Spring was in the air for Taylor Swift who became the first female artist ever to win album of the year three times. She looked fabulous in the flowery Oscar de la Renta dress.
